Does acetylsalicylic acid or warfarin affect the accuracy of fecal occult blood tests?

Abstract

BACKGROUND: Current guidelines for screening of colorectal cancer do not offer specific recommendations for cessation of antithrombotic agents prior to fecal occult blood test (FOBT). AIM: To asess the accuracy of FOBT in patients taking acetylsalicylic acid (ASA) or warfarin.
